Pointers post eighth shutout of the season

Box Score Box Score

MADISON – The UW-Stevens Point women's soccer team improved to 8-3-1 on the season with a 2-0 defeat of the Eagles of Edgewood College Sunday afternoon.

Vicki Bieschke (Oconomowoc) tallied her sixth goal of the season at the 25:44 mark of the first half off a Mary Jean Cornelius (West Bend) pass to give the Pointers the early one goal edge.

Just over twelve minutes into the second half, Kirsti Nickels (Appleton) joined in on the scoring action, notching her fifth goal of the season off a Jackie Spees (Wisconsin Rapids) crossing pass, giving the Pointers the 2-0 edge.

The rest of the way, the Pointer defense held stout, not allowing a single second-half shot by the Eagles and no shots on goal the entire game, as goalkeeper Liz Hunter (Stevens Point/SPASH) tallied her eighth shutout of the season, not recording a save in the game.

UW-Stevens Point returns to action on Wednesday, Oct. 14 when they travel to La Crosse for a 5 p.m. match-up with the Eagles before returning home to face UW-Eau Claire on Saturday, Oct. 17.
